About The Position

The Chancellor’s Office is recruiting two Administrative Specialists to support senior leadership within the Office of the Chancellor and the Office of External and Government Relations. These offices play a central role in advancing the University of Wisconsin–Milwaukee’s mission through executive leadership support, strategic partnerships, government relations, and engagement with internal and external stakeholders. Reporting to senior leadership, the Administrative Specialist serves as a trusted administrative and operational partner, providing high-level coordination and executive support to ensure efficient, compliant, and professional office operations. This role requires discretion, strong organizational skills, sound judgment, and the ability to manage competing priorities while supporting leadership decision-making and high-profile engagements.

Responsibilities

  • Provide executive-level administrative support to senior leadership, including workflow coordination, communications, and follow-through on key initiatives.
  • Prepare briefings, background materials, schedules, and logistical support for meetings, events, and engagements.
  • Anticipate administrative needs and proactively address operational issues.
  • Coordinate purchasing, expense tracking, and documentation in compliance with university policies.
  • Support records management, reporting, audits, and confidentiality requirements.
  • Manage complex calendars and coordinate travel arrangements, meetings, events, and official functions involving university leadership.
  • Handle logistics such as room reservations, catering, visitor access, parking, and materials.
  • Maintain shared calendars, collaboration tools, websites, and internal tracking systems to support office operations and outreach.
  • Oversee day-to-day office operations and maintain efficient administrative systems and processes.
  • Serve as the primary point of contact for office logistics, facilities, IT coordination, onboarding, and general administrative needs.
